Output 340d356840a58c8611e6e9dbcf425de1e995e4056f3673353bf61c899ec2feb6:0

value
562758
script pubkey
OP_0 OP_PUSHBYTES_20 364f143f356990b193c56a526f003e5777829834
address
bc1qxe83g0e4dxgtry79dffx7qp72amc9xp5mzjr4c
transaction
340d356840a58c8611e6e9dbcf425de1e995e4056f3673353bf61c899ec2feb6
spent
true